The global hospital capacity management solutions market size is expected to reach USD 9.55 billion by 2028 according to a new study by Polaris Market Research. The report “Hospital Capacity Management Solutions Market Share, Size, Trends, Industry Analysis Report, By Mode of Delivery (On-premises, Cloud-based); By Product; By End-Use; By Region; Segment Forecast, 2021 – 2028” gives a detailed insight into current market dynamics and provides analysis on future market growth.

Hospitals focusing on better workforce managing and reducing operation cost, are the key industry growth driver. Governments across the globe are investing in empowering the healthcare system to deliver better results which can be achieved through the hospital capacity managing systems and thus have promising development opportunities in the coming years.

Private and public healthcare sector is working towards achieving optimum workforce managing with proper asset utilization as it aids in reducing operational cost deliver satisfying results which is anticipated to propel the industry demand over the forecast period.

Hospital Capacity Management Solutions Market Forecast till 2028

In they year 2020, asset managing dominated the industry due to its increasing demand in hospitals for supplies tracking, provide training to the workforce, and equipment managing which further aids in saving resources and time.

North America dominated the market in the year 2020, owing to the implementation of new technologies in the region for improved healthcare. Developed IT infrastructure acts as a catalyst for the demand for the capacity managing systems. Several players are investing in the expansion to gain a larger market share which is anticipated to drive the industry over the coming years.

Major players in the capacity managing market are Teletracking Technologies, Inc. (US), NextGen Healthcare (US), Allscripts Healthcare Solutions, Inc. (US), Epic Systems Corporation (US), Koninklijke Philips N.V. (Netherlands), Neusoft Corporation (China), Infinitt Healthcare Co., Ltd. (South Korea), Infor Systems (US), JVS Group (India).

Alcidion Corporation acquired Extramed and UK based patient flow software company on 15th of April 2021, which strengthen companies’ presence in UK for delivering smart technology systems in healthcare. HealthStream a US-based company acquire Change Healthcare’s Staff Scheduling Business in the year 2020, which empowered the organization to gain a competitive edge in the workforce scheduling and capacity managing solutions market. Stanley Healthcare partnered with Cisco DNA Spaces in the year 2020, which enable the organization to integrate its AeroScout RTLS with Cisco DNA spaces which enhanced and simplify operations of healthcare companies.
